@galerians: The aunts who were at the beginning of Gilead are unmarried former lawyers, teachers, judges, etc. And for those girls who already want to become an aunt during Gilead, you need to:
go through an interview with all four founding aunts and convince them that your vocation is really to be an aunt.
complete a probation period of half a year, show your worth (clean, wash dishes, etc.). You are already allowed to start writing and reading
Access to the library opens. You need to complete the training, which lasts 9 years.
As a pearl maiden, you need to go outside Gilead, recruit other girls there, and then return with your "pearls" back. That's all, the way is over. You're an aunt now :)
